发明名称 MULTIPOINT CONTACT BALL BEARING
摘要 PROBLEM TO BE SOLVED: To provide a multipoint contact ball bearing to facilitate reduction of friction torque, prevention of wear, and improvement of durability by high- efficient improvement of surface coarseness of the raceway surface of a race when the race having a track surface making contact with a steel ball at two points consists of a single ring member. SOLUTION: The outer ring 12 of a two-piece inner ring type four-point contact ball bearing 10 consists of a single ring member of which a raceway surface 12a having the sectional shape of a Gothic arch is formed. Barreling is by a centrifugal barreling machine is applied on an outer ring 12 to improve surface coarseness of the raceway surface 12a. When barreling is executed by the centrifugal barreling machine for 12 hours in seccession, surface coarseness of the outer ring 12 having surface coarseness of 0.3μmRa before barreling is improved to 0.06μmRa.
